Numbers 14:36

And the men which Moses sent to search the land
Ten of them, who returned;
as they all did, who were sent to search it: and made all the congregation to murmur against him;
against, Moses that sent them; they murmured themselves, and made others murmur: by bringing up a slander upon the land;
that it ate up its inhabitants, and that the inhabitants of it were of such a stature, and so gigantic and strong, and dwelt in such walled cities, ( Numbers 13:28 Numbers 13:29 ) , that there was no probability of subduing them, ( Numbers 13:31-33 ) .

Numbers 14:36 In-Context

34 “‘Because your men explored the land for forty days, you must wander in the wilderness for forty years—a year for each day, suffering the consequences of your sins. Then you will discover what it is like to have me for an enemy.’
35 I, the LORD, have spoken! I will certainly do these things to every member of the community who has conspired against me. They will be destroyed here in this wilderness, and here they will die!”
36 The ten men Moses had sent to explore the land—the ones who incited rebellion against the LORD with their bad report—
37 were struck dead with a plague before the LORD .
38 Of the twelve who had explored the land, only Joshua and Caleb remained alive.
